A Southern blot is a laboratory method used to detect specific DNA molecules from among a many other DNA molecules.
Northern blotting is a molecular biology technique used to study gene expression by detecting and analyzing specific RNA molecules in a sample. It involves electrophoresis to separate RNA fragments by size and hybridization with a labeled probe to identify target RNA sequences.
Southern blotting \textbf{Southern blotting} Southern blotting is used as hybridization method that detects a specific target gene of interest among other DNA molecules present in a sample.
Southern blotting is used to detect specific DNA sequence in a given sample of DNA. The first step in a Southern blot is to prepare the DNA mixture by breaking it into small fragments using a restriction enzyme. The mixture of DNA fragments is then separated ing to size by gel electrophoresis.
The bands formed on the gel are then transferred to a nitrocellulose paper or nylon membrane through the technique called hybridization (blotting technique).
Southern blotting allows the detection of a given DNA sequence in a complex mixture of DNA sequences. It can be used to identify homologous sequences in genomic DNA, or to facilitate gene mapping through restriction mapping of genes or in the detection of restriction fragment length polymorphisms.
Western blotting techniques are used to transfer the protein molecules from acrylamide gels to membranes for further procedures. Explanation: Western blotting involves a transfer of electrophoresed protein bands from a polyacrylamide gel on to a nitrocellulose or nylon membrane.
Compared with chromatography, the Southern blot approach increases the detection resolution to a level that may be useful for examining specific genomic loci. However, it still requires a large amount of starting DNA, and the efficiency of restriction enzyme activity could affect the detection accuracy.
